    I'm still trying unsuccessfully to = upgrade OpenSSL.  Here's the error when I
    do a make install:-

    ---------------------------------------------------------= ---
    Can't locate Pod/Man.pm in @INC (@INC = contains:
    /usr/local/lib/perl5/site_perl/5.005/i386-freebsd
    /usr/local/lib/perl5/site_perl/5.005 = . /usr/libdata/perl/5.00503/mach
    /usr/libdata/perl/5.00503) at = /usr/bin/pod2man line 16.
    BEGIN failed--compilation aborted at = /usr/bin/pod2man line 16.
    *** Error code 2

    Stop in = /usr/ports/security/openssl/work/openssl-0.9.6e.
    *** Error code 1

    Stop in = /usr/ports/security/openssl.
    ---------------------------------------------------------= ---

    I'm running a fairly standard 4.6 = (upgraded frpm 4.5) install.  I've double
    checked the install of the perl = modules that the error message quotes and
    can't see anything wrong.  Any = help would be greatly appreciated.
